Duties and Responsibilities
(Note: * denotes Essential Functions)
1. Process sediment samples according to EPA approved methods for faunal analyses
2. *Identify and count specimens extracted from sediment samples using regional keys and laboratory 3 reference keys
3. *Assist other laboratory staff with maintaining specimen reference collections, files, and grain size analysis.
4. Search scientific literature for species descriptions and resources
5. Other duties as assigned

Desirable Qualifications
1. Experience with benthic sample processing and specimen identification
2. Experience with approved EPA methods for faunal analyses and granulometric processes
3. Ability to prepare sketches of specimens using the microscope
4. Ability to observe, analyze, and report objectively the results of research experimentation
